    Surely you understand that words express connotations as well as denotations. "Elegant" and "majestic" are in fact nearly identical in both dimensions; I, the Head Linguist around here, had to look them up in a dictionary to find even the slightest difference between them in a modern American context.

    But that's hardly true in the case of "black person" and the N word. The N word simply had to be replaced because it was the word that slaveholders used for their "property" and the word itself evoked images of an era and a condition that triggered a reaction of grief in African-Americans and their champions. Words can do that just as music and other sounds, visual images, even smells and tastes can do. You can't possibly not know this.

    America spent the entire 20th century fighting a cultural and political battle over the proper, dignified name for members of that ethnic group. "Colored people" was just stupid because all of our skins have pigment. "Negro" sounded too much like the N-word, especially out of the mouths of even the most sympathetic Southerners because of their accent, the very accent that turned the Spanish word negro into the N-word in the first place. Since the 1960s we've been waffling between "black" and "African-American."

    Personally I don't like "black." It makes it sound like we're resigned to having separate communities of "black" and "white" Americans forever, without them ever intermarrying and turning into a population of various shades of brown like the other former slaveholding countries in the Western Hemisphere. "African-American" is more like "Italian-American," "German-American" and "Mexican-American." Those were all immigrant cultures that were assimilated into the Melting Pot and made America stronger. To me it's a more optimistic word. It has a more positive connotation for me, despite having an identical denotation.

    But that's just me. Both of those words are neutral to the ears of most Americans of all backgrounds. They carry no negative connotations. The N-word does.
